Title:ReadPlease
Annotation:ReadPlease 2003 is a text-to-speech application designed to give yourcomputer a human-sounding voice so it can read arbitrary text to you,from Web pages, e-mail, or the Clipboard. Through file-typeassociation, the program can read any text file or Rich Text Formatfile directly from the Internet.
Howto Use: Copy and paste text from any document into the windowprovided and the text will be “read” to you.
Location:www.readplease.com;http://www.download.com/ReadPlease-2003/3000-7239_4-10137511.html
Reviews:Editor’s review at download.com
Whilewe applaud this text-to-speech application for being freeware, it hastoo many shortcomings to put it on a recommended list. ReadPlease2003 uses Microsoft speech engines to read text you choose. Yet to doso, you must cut and paste a body of text into the program's mainwindow, a step we found cumbersome. Customization features are verylimited. You can choose only from four voices, and there is no optionto adjust voice pitch, speed, or even pronunciation. Another handyfeature we would like to see is the option to skip ahead in textwhile reading. And ReadPlease 2003 isn't able to record files forlater listening, either. Overall, despite its freeware status,ReadPlease 2003 doesn't stand up to similar available readerprograms.

Title:A.D.A.M.Online Anatomy
A.D.A.M.online anatomy is a comprehensive database of detailed anatomicalimages that allows users to point, click and identify more than20,000 anatomical structures within fully dissectible male and femalebodies in anterior, lateral, medial and posterior views. The user isable to dissect the body layer by layer or use a scroll bar tonavigate deeper. This unique 'dissection' applicationoffers an interactive approach to discovering the human body.A.D.A.M. online anatomy enhances learning, teaching and sharing ofanatomical information.

Title:TheCell is A City 3D
Annotation:The Neotek version of The Cell is a City takes the viewer on aninteractive 3-D journey into the inside of actual cells using VirtualReality techniques. The CD-ROM can also be used in 2-D mode withoutusing the Neotek hardware (purchased separately). This CD-ROM isbased on the Atlas of the Cell. The CD-ROM uses only real electronmicrographs of real cells, not computer generated images or drawings.The viewer will be able to view more than 80 scanned electronmicroscope image pairs. Comprehensive, on-line text accompanies eachimage and compares the inner workings of a cell to those of an actualcity. Contents: The Cell: Prokaryotic & Eukaryotic; What HoldsCells Together; The Cell Membrane & Its Modifications; TheNucleus; Endoplasmic Reticulum; Golgi Complex; Lysosomes;Intracellular Chemistry; Mitochondria; The Cytoskeleton; CellTransport; Plant Cells.

Title:ScreensaverProtein Builder 2.0
Annotation:The Protein Builder Screensaver is part of the Distributed FoldingProject, an experiment in distributed computing through the Internetto help solve the Protein Folding Problem, one of the computationallyintensive problems facing scientists of the 21st century. The programprobabilistically generates protein structures, and uploads them toour server every once in a while. A colorful protein will builditself up on your screen as the program generates structures so youcan see how many you have made and how fast it is progressing.
HowTo Use: This is a screensaver you can install. When you want to useyour computer again, simply move the mouse or hit a key.
